The electronic configuration of transition elements is exhibited by
Options
(a) ns¹
(b) ns²np⁵
(c) ns² (n – 1) d¹⁻¹⁰
(d) ns² (n – 1)d¹⁰
Correct Answer:
ns² (n – 1) d¹⁻¹⁰
